The number 4 knife handle is specifically designed to accommodate a range of blade sizes that typically includes those labeled #20 to #25. This handle is part of a classification system where certain handle sizes correspond with specific blade sizes to ensure proper ergonomics and functionality during tasks.

The design of the number 4 handle ensures a secure grip and allows for better control when utilizing blades in this range, which are generally larger and used for different applications like cutting through tougher materials or performing more significant incisions. It’s important for users to match handles and blades correctly to minimize the risk of accidents or improper use.
